UPDATE.... I just got off the phone with paypal... they said to me that there are multiple claims against the hollisterdout@yahoo.com account. For my claim he has until the 22nd, if he does not respond by then with tracking numbers from the shipping company, and signatures of the merchandise being recieved, then when the clock runs out 1/22 for me, my return will be made instantly back to my account. Why am i mentioning this.... any purchase made over 250 U.S dollars has to be signed for, paypal requests this proof of sellers in order for sellers to keep their money. So if you purchased through paypal and have a purchase over $250, then just make sure you have escalated the dispute to a claim. The timer is 10 days from the time it becomes a claim, if there is no repsonse with proof by the end of the 10 days, they refund you your money no matter what and then they go after him. I was told if i dont have merchandise then i get my money back.... that simple. So if your on the paypal side of things dont worry as much, i still want this m**********r to get caught and learn what its like to play with the big boys. For anyone who made smaller purschases, call paypal for their requirements of getting your money back.
I hope this helps relieve some stress for you guys that purchased on paypal.
***Note*** as for the escrow website that was provided earlier, if your going to make a purchase its a good deal. Im an auctioneer and when high ticket cars sell, we recommend it to the buyers if they are selling for resale. Otherwise paypal is a really safe way to go. Paypal has all sorts of strategic alliances with all major shippers; UPS, Fed-Ex, DHL, etc... they can see if the tracking information and signatures are valid or if they are bogus BS.
If you have a dispute, escalate it to a claim asap, as mentioned in an earlier thread you only have so much time before you can make claims against sellers.
